BRMC Seeking Donations for Needy School Children
Posted on: 08/12/2011
Bradford Regional Medical Center Seeking Donations
for Needy School Children
What: As part of its Community Connections initiative, Bradford Regional Medical Center is collecting donations from employees to help fill backpacks with school supplies for needy children. Community members are welcome to donate as well.
The hospital is accepting the following items:
• Pencils
• Pens
• Crayons
• Markers
• Hand sanitizer
• Wet wipes
• Pocket tissues
• Scissors (blunt tip)
• Loose leaf paper (college ruled)
• Spiral notebooks
• Pencil boxes
• Folders
Who: Donations will benefit up to 100 elementary school students.
When: Donations will be accepted through Friday, September 2, 2011
Where: Collection bins are located in the following areas at Bradford Regional Medical Center:
· The Pavilion at BRMC - Administrative Office
· Cafeteria
· Nurses Station – “3 East” Wing
· Radiology Department
